La Classique Morbihan returns for its 10th edition in 2025, continuing its established place as the Friday fixture in Brittany’s two-day pairing with the GP de Plumelec-Morbihan. While Saturday’s race retains a slightly greater prestige, the Morbihan event has increasingly built its own character and significance on the calendar.

The Friday slot can sometimes result in a less controlled race. With some teams balancing ambitions across the weekend, La Classique Morbihan often delivers surprises – breakaway wins, reduced sprints, and unexpected names on the podium have all been regular features.

Italian riders have been particularly successful here, with Eleonora Gasparrini taking the 2024 edition in a rain-soaked sprint, extending a streak that has also seen victories from Gaia Masetti and Antri Christoforou in recent years. The solo nature of those previous wins highlights how difficult this race can be to manage, especially with limited time to organise a coherent chase.

The 2025 route again finishes in Josselin after 112.6km of racing, including six laps of a final circuit that culminates in a short, punchy uphill drag to the line. While not selective in a traditional mountain sense, the climb and twisting approach thin out the peloton with each pass. It’s a course that rewards positioning and race craft. Riders need to be alert to the possibility of late attacks, especially if the bunch hesitates. In previous editions, a lone escapee has often hovered just out of reach, with the catch, or failure to do so, proving decisive.

The course’s narrow, technical sections can cause splits, and in poor weather the risk of crashes increases. In 2024, slippery conditions turned the finale into a test of handling as well as strength. Riders who manage to stay upright and avoid mechanical issues already gain an advantage before the race is even decided on legs.
